Effective approaches include Compassion-Focused Therapy (developed specifically for chronic shame and self-criticism), Internal Family Systems (IFS), schema therapy for the deeper templates that drive low self-worth,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) for unhooking from self-critical thoughts, and trauma-informed work when self-esteem is rooted in early experiences of rejection, criticism, or neglect. Self-esteem rarely shifts through affirmations alone — sustainable change usually requires understanding where the inner critic came, what it's been protecting you, and what it would take for it to relax.
